The Course

Our ESOL study programme is designed for 16-19 year-olds whose first language is not English, who are living or trying to settle in the UK. The programme is designed to help you improve your English skills, to get more out of your life in the UK and to make it easier to study a qualification and help you progress to employment.

Why choose us? We offer ESOL courses at different levels to meet your specific needs, starting at Pre-Entry Level for those who cannot read, write or speak any English, through to Level 2 programmes. Our ESOL study programme includes maths and citizenship qualifications to develop your understanding of British culture.

You will cover various aspects of English including:

  • Speaking
  • Listening
  • Reading
  • Writing

On completion of the course, you could go on to further training or employment. The courses are delivered at our Crewe and Ellesmere Port Campuses.
